Other Restaurants near The Fort Strip, 26th Street, Bonifacio Global City, Taguig City - Page 16
Showing 151 - 152 of 152
Andok's, San Pedro
Other RestaurantsApproximately 1.99 KM away
Address : B Morcilla Street, San Pedro, Pateros City, Philippines
Goto Topps, Guadalupe
Other RestaurantsApproximately 1.99 KM away
Address : Super 8 Grocery Warehouse, Guadalupe Station, Guadalupe, Makati City, Philippines